HC Deb 08 February 1999 vol 325 c107W
Mr. Chaytor

To ask the Secretary of State for Education and Employment if he will list the administrative costs for each of the last five years, as a percentage of the total budget, for(a) the Higher Education Funding Council, (b) the Further Education Funding Council and (c) training and enterprise councils, expressed as the national average figure, for that proportion of their responsibilities which is comparable with the responsibilities of the FEFC and the HEFC. [67670]

Mr. Mudie

[holding answer 28 January 1999]: The information that my hon. Friend has requested is listed in the table. The three figures are not comparable because of differences in responsibilities between TECs, the HEFCE and the FEFC. Accordingly, as with HEFCE and FEFC, TEC percentages have been calculated on total administrative costs and budgets. The percentage figure for TECs is much higher than either of the others because TECs are themselves directly involved in local business support and economic development.

Percentage
Year HEFCE FEFC TECS
1993–94 0.37 0.92 12
1994–95 0.35 0.82 11
1995–96 0.33 0.79 12
1996–97 0.37 0.74 12
1997–98 0.29 0.76 13
